Simulating Volvo Truck ECU for Training and Analysis
Volvo trucks are renowned for their reliability, making them a popular choice in the transportation industry. To ensure optimal performance and maintenance, technicians require comprehensive training on these complex vehicles. Simulating a Volvo truck's Engine Control Unit (ECU) provides an invaluable platform for both education and analysis. Through simulation, trainees can engage with various scenarios, gaining hands-on experience in diagnosing and resolving faults. Furthermore, ECU simulations allow engineers to test the truck's performance under diverse operating conditions, leading to improvements in fuel efficiency, emissions reduction, and overall vehicle design.
- Advantages of ECU Simulation:
- Enhanced training for technicians
- Streamlined diagnostics and troubleshooting
- Real-world performance analysis under controlled conditions
- Accelerated development of new truck technologies
